"St. Elmo's Fire (Man in Motion)" is included on the 1985 London Records issue of the album (#LONLP 12) in the UK.
[2] It hit number one on the Billboard Hot 100 on September 7, 1985, remaining there for two weeks.
It was the main theme for the Joel Schumacher's 1985 film St. Elmo's Fire.
